Overview

On October 28, 2023, the NC State football team pulled off a stunning upset against ACC rival Clemson, winning 24-17 on their homecoming game. The victory is significant, as it not only handed Clemson their second consecutive loss but also marked their fourth loss of the season. The win solidifies NC State’s position and keeps them in contention in the ACC. While Clemson was favored to win by most sports books and ESPN’s prognostication formula gave them a 75.6% chance to win, NC State’s solid defense, standout performances from freshman wide receiver Kevin “KC” Concepcion, and clutch kicking played critical roles in securing the upset.

Analysis

Defense is the best offense

NC State’s head coach, Dave Doeren, has consistently emphasized the importance of winning the turnover battle, and the Pack delivered on that front during the game against Clemson. Two of NC State’s touchdowns came directly from turnovers, showcasing the strength of their defense. Safety Devan Boykin intercepted a pass from Clemson quarterback Cade Klubnik, which led to a 9-yard touchdown pass from quarterback MJ Morris to wide receiver Kevin “KC” Concepcion. Linebacker Payton Wilson also recorded his first career pick six in the third quarter, intercepting another pass from Klubnik and returning it 15 yards to the end zone. Additionally, Jaylon Scott’s forced fumble in the fourth quarter pushed the Tigers back 17 yards, preventing them from making up the deficit and forcing them to punt. The defensive prowess of NC State played a crucial role in securing the victory.

KC Concepcion carries offense

Freshman wide receiver Kevin “KC” Concepcion was a standout player for NC State, contributing significantly to the team’s victory. Concepcion recorded his third game of the season with at least 100 yards, showcasing his versatility and impact on the game. He contributed 51 rushing yards and 83 receiving yards, delivering two touchdown catches. Concepcion’s impressive performance was particularly crucial considering NC State’s offensive struggles throughout the game. The team finished with just 201 total yards, including only 20 passing yards at halftime. The offensive line protection was lacking, as evidenced by the multiple sacks on Morris and Armstrong. Concepcion and the defenders played a vital role in covering up these issues and ensuring victory.

Kicking comes up clutch

NC State’s consistent special teams efforts were once again influential in the game against Clemson. Place kicker Brayden Narveson played a crucial role in securing the victory with a 41-yard field goal in the second quarter, giving the Pack a 10-point lead. Narveson’s successful field goal streak continued, making it his seventh straight successful field goal this season. On the other hand, Clemson‘s place kicker, Jonathan Weitz, missed a 43-yard field goal attempt, highlighting the difference in kicking performances. While one field goal might not seem significant, it provided NC State with major momentum before halftime and ultimately contributed to their victory.
